You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
iceraven-browser/app/src/main/java/org/mozilla/fenix
Lina Butler 3ba6593f98 Bug 1851268 - Show Firefox Suggest search suggestions in Fenix.
This commit integrates the Firefox Suggest Android component added in
bug 1850296 into Fenix, and adds:

* A Nimbus feature for Firefox Suggest.
* A secret setting to enable the Firefox Suggest feature, only visible
  on the debug channel.
* Search settings for toggling sponsored and non-sponsored suggestions,
  only visible when the Firefox Suggest feature is enabled.

When the feature is enabled, Fenix will ingest new suggestions in
the background, show the new Search settings, and show matching
suggestions in the awesomebar depending on those Search settings.
9 months ago
..
addons Bug 1850783 - Add button to open AMO from the fenix add-on manager 9 months ago
android Bug 1839239 - Add crash bread crumbs for dialogs. 11 months ago
autofill [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
browser Bug 1840090 - Update content description string for shopping experience 9 months ago
collections Bug 1812730 - Prevent collections with empty name from being created 10 months ago
components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
compose Bug 1840090 - Add content strings for shopping experience 9 months ago
crashes Bug 1839239 - Add crash bread crumbs for dialogs. 11 months ago
customtabs Bug 1850933 - Override onProvideAssistContent in ExternalAppBrowserActivity 9 months ago
datastore [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
downloads Bug 1839239 - Add crash bread crumbs for dialogs. 11 months ago
exceptions [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
experiments Bug 1841262 — Add coenrolling features to NimbusBuilder 11 months ago
ext Bug 1829018 - Remove and clean up `Settings.enableTaskContinuityEnhancements` 9 months ago
extension Bug 1852967 - Update mozac_feature_addons_blocklisted strings 9 months ago
gecko Bug 1850280 - Control extensions process rollout with Nimbus 10 months ago
historymetadata [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
home Bug 1837526 - Call StartupTimeline in the Compose Top Sites 9 months ago
intent [fenix] For https://github.com/mozilla-mobile/fenix/issues/23596 and https://github.com/mozilla-mobile/fenix/issues/23309 - Add deeplink to wallpaper settings 2 years ago
library Bug 1854700 - Only open history item if host activity is available 9 months ago
lifecycle Bug 1820211 - Adds `tabKilled` event to track when a tab was killed with form data. (#1343) 1 year ago
media Bug 1796348 - Add a notification delegate to MediaSessionService. 1 year ago
messaging Bug 1838613 - Migrate NotificationManagerCompat ext to AC 12 months ago
nimbus Bug 1842039 - Add bread crumbs for IllegalArgumentException when navigating. 10 months ago
onboarding Bug 1853707 - Send Search Widget telemetry when primary button tapped 9 months ago
perf Bug 1837526 - Call StartupTimeline in the Compose Top Sites 9 months ago
push Bug 1829982: Fixes push breaking changes for AS 1 year ago
search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
selection
session Bug 1823367 - When closing Fenix in private mode, the ETP setting should have the default value. 1 year ago
settings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
share Bug 1840471 - Release Menu Printing out of Nightly 10 months ago
shopping Bug 1840113 - Display review checker info cards 9 months ago
shortcut Bug 1837961 - Part 2:Replace usages of ifChanged to distinctUntilChanged 12 months ago
sync [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
tabhistory Bug 1837961 - Part 2:Replace usages of ifChanged to distinctUntilChanged 12 months ago
tabstray Bug 1852623 - Fix list tab reordering animation when dragging first element 9 months ago
telemetry Bug 1842604 - Telemetry to measure Search results response time 11 months ago
theme Bug 1851186 - Add new design system color tokens 9 months ago
trackingprotection Bug 1837961 - Part 2:Replace usages of ifChanged to distinctUntilChanged 12 months ago
utils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
wallpapers Bug 1840210 - Rename mozac_ic_close to mozac_ic_cross_24 11 months ago
whatsnew [fenix] For https://github.com/mozilla-mobile/fenix/issues/25808: Remove unnecessary elvis operator. 2 years ago
widget Bug 1822392 - Remove stray GMS reference for annotation 1 year ago
wifi [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
AppRequestInterceptor.kt [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
BrowserDirection.kt Bug 1847740 - Add navigation middleware for review quality check 10 months ago
Config.kt Bug 1807324 - Add macrobenchmarks for startup metrics 1 year ago
FeatureFlags.kt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
FenixApplication.kt Bug 1851268 - Show Firefox Suggest search suggestions in Fenix. 9 months ago
FenixLogSink.kt Bug 1825071 - Refactor FenixLogSink to remove mockkStatic usage. 1 year ago
GlobalDirections.kt Bug 1804274: Adds entrypoints for firefox accounts 1 year ago
HomeActivity.kt Bug 1848188 - Remove Nimbus flag for Juno Onboarding 9 months ago
IntentReceiverActivity.kt Bug 1810629 - Add an Android shortcut to go straight to the login and passwords 1 year ago
MozillaOnlineHomeActivity.kt Bug 1825799 - Make MozillaOnlineHomeActivity final by default. 1 year ago
NavHostActivity.kt
OnBackLongPressedListener.kt
SecureFragment.kt
ServiceWorkerSupportFeature.kt [fenix] For https://github.com/mozilla-mobile/fenix/issues/26844: Fix ktlint issues and remove them from baseline. 2 years ago
StartupFragment.kt [fenix] Closes https://github.com/mozilla-mobile/fenix/issues/21759: Do not render home fragment when launching to tab 3 years ago